Legal bases for data processing

Data processing processes at Betonred are based on the following legal foundations:

  • Contract performance: When data is necessary to provide services requested by the user.
  • Legal obligation: When Polish regulations impose on us the obligation to verify identity or age.
  • Legitimate interest: To ensure network cybersecurity and fraud detection.
  • User consent: For voluntary additional services.

User rights arising from the GDPR

Every user has the right to:

  • Right to access their data and receive a copy of it.
  • Right to rectify incorrect information.
  • Right to erasure of data ("right to be forgotten").
  • Right to restriction of data processing.
  • Right to object to processing based on legitimate interest.
